Understanding Libido
Libido refers to a person’s overall sexual drive or desire for sexual activity. While it’s a completely normal aspect of human life, libido can fluctuate due to a variety of factors, including hormonal changes, stress levels, physical health, and relationship dynamics. According to a study published in the Journal of Sexual Medicine, nearly 40% of men and 63% of women experience some form of sexual dysfunction, which can include low libido. This decline can be distressing, but the good news is that there are numerous ways to identify and address the issue.
The Science Behind Libido
Hormones play a pivotal role in regulating libido. Testosterone, often dubbed the "male hormone," is crucial for boosting sexual desire in both men and women. However, while testosterone can influence libido, it’s not the sole contributor. Other hormones, such as estrogen and oxytocin, also impact sexual desire. Psychological factors, such as mood, self-esteem, and mental health, combined with physical health conditions, can all contribute to sexual appetites.
Factors Affecting Libido
-
Age: As individuals get older, hormonal levels naturally decrease. For women, menopause brings a notable decline in estrogen, which can affect libido. Similarly, men may experience a decrease in testosterone levels with age.
-
Stress and Anxiety: The pressures of daily life can significantly affect sexual desire. Chronic stress leads to elevated cortisol levels, which may suppress libido.
-
Relationship Dynamics: Emotional connections, compatibility, and communication play crucial roles in sexual desire. Couples experiencing conflict or lack of intimacy often report lower levels of libido.
-
Physical Health: Conditions such as diabetes, heart disease, obesity, and hormonal imbalances can adversely affect sexual desire.
- Medications: Various medications, including antidepressants, anti-anxiety drugs, and certain blood pressure medications, can have side effects that lower libido.
Effective Tips to Boost Your Libido
1. Open Communication with Your Partner
Discussing your sexual desires and fears openly with your partner can deepen intimacy and connection. Dr. Laura Berman, a renowned sex and relationship expert, emphasizes that "open dialogue is essential; understanding each other’s needs can create a safer, more inviting space for intimacy."
2. Prioritize Emotional Intimacy
Emotional connection fosters physical intimacy. Make time to bond outside the bedroom—engage in activities you both enjoy, share your thoughts and feelings, and cultivate a supportive environment. Studies suggest that partners who feel emotionally connected are more likely to experience higher levels of sexual desire.
3. Manage Stress Through Relaxation Techniques
Incorporating relaxation techniques such as mindfulness, meditation, and yoga can help reduce stress levels—an important factor for boosting libido. A study published in the American Journal of Health Promotion found that individuals who practiced mindfulness reported improved sexual satisfaction.
4. Maintain a Healthy Diet
Your diet plays a significant role in your sexual health. Foods such as avocados, bananas, dark chocolate, and nuts are known as "libido-boosting" foods due to their nutrient content. Zinc-rich foods like oysters and pumpkin seeds also contribute to higher testosterone levels.
Example: A 2021 study in The Journal of Sexual Medicine noted that a Mediterranean diet is associated with improved sexual function due to its high content of healthy fats, antioxidants, and vitamins.
5. Regular Exercise
Engaging in regular physical activity is crucial for overall health—including sexual health. Exercise increases blood flow, boosts mood, and raises testosterone levels.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ise each week, which includes aerobic activities complemented by strength training.
Expert Tip: Celebrity trainer and author Jillian Michaels suggests incorporating exercises that increase heart rate and promote flexibility. "Not only does this enhance your stamina, but it also boosts your body image, making you feel more confident in the bedroom."
6. Get Enough Sleep
Lack of quality sleep can negatively impact hormonal levels, including testosterone. Prioritize sleep by establishing a consistent sleep schedule and creating a restful environment. Studies show that individuals who prioritize sleep experience higher libido and improved sexual satisfaction.
7. Explore New Experiences
Spicing up your routine can reignite passion in your relationship. Consider exploring new activities together or experimenting with different forms of intimacy. Whether it’s a weekend getaway, trying new sexual practices, or simply being adventurous in planning date nights, breaking the monotony can enhance your bond.
8. Limit Alcohol and Quit Smoking
While moderate alcohol consumption may lower inhibitions, excessive intake can inhibit sexual performance and desire. Similarly, smoking has been linked to reduced libido and erectile dysfunction. Consider moderating alcohol consumption and seeking resources to quit smoking if needed.
9. Seek Professional Help
If low libido persists despite these efforts, consider consulting a healthcare professional or sex therapist. They can provide personalized advice and treatment options, considering any underlying health issues that may contribute to your decreased sexual desire.
10. Consider Herbal Remedies and Supplements
Some individuals explore herbal remedies to naturally boost libido. Ingredients such as maca root, ginseng, and Tribulus terrestris have traditionally been used to enhance sexual desire. However, it’s crucial to consult a healthcare professional before starting any new supplement, as results can vary and individual health considerations must be taken into account.

FAQs
1. What are some common causes of low libido in women?
Common causes include hormonal changes (such as during menopause), stress, relationship issues, medical conditions, medications, and mental health concerns such as depression and anxiety.
2. Can diet affect my sexual desire?
Yes, diet plays a significant role in sexual health. Foods rich in antioxidants, healthy fats, and vitamins can improve overall health and may increase libido.
3. How can I naturally boost testosterone levels?
Natural methods include regular exercise, maintaining a balanced diet, managing stress, and ensuring adequate sleep.
4. Is it normal for libido to fluctuate?
Yes, fluctuations in libido are normal. Various factors including age, health, and relationship dynamics can influence desire at different times.
5. When should I seek professional help?
If you experience persistent low libido that affects your quality of life, relationships, or overall well-being, it’s advisable to seek professional guidance. Healthcare providers can offer insights and treatment options tailored to your needs.
